MySQL服务登陆指南:轻松入门教程

资源类型:70-0.net 2025-07-17 12:39

mysql服务登陆简介:



MySQL服务登陆:解锁数据库管理的高效之门 在当今信息化高速发展的时代,数据库作为信息系统的核心组件,承载着数据存储、检索和处理的重任

    MySQL,作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、可靠性、易用性和广泛的社区支持,已成为众多企业和开发者的首选

    然而,要想充分发挥MySQL的强大功能,首先必须掌握MySQL服务的登陆技巧,这是通往数据库管理高效之门的钥匙

    本文将深入探讨MySQL服务登陆的重要性、基本步骤、常见问题及解决方案,以及提升登陆安全性的策略,旨在帮助读者熟练掌握这一关键技能

     一、MySQL服务登陆的重要性 MySQL服务登陆是数据库管理的第一步,也是最为基础且至关重要的一环

    它不仅是访问和操作数据库的前提,更是确保数据安全、实施权限控制和维护数据库健康运行的基石

     1.数据访问权限控制:通过登陆验证,MySQL能够确认用户身份,根据预设的权限分配策略,允许或拒绝用户对数据库的访问和操作

    这是保护数据不被非法访问和篡改的第一道防线

     2.数据安全与合规性:严格的登陆流程有助于遵守数据保护法规(如GDPR、HIPAA等),确保数据的合法收集、处理和存储,降低法律风险

     3.系统监控与维护:管理员通过登陆MySQL服务,可以执行数据库备份、性能调优、故障排查等维护任务,保障数据库的稳定运行和高效性能

     4.权限管理与审计:登陆记录是审计跟踪的重要依据,有助于追踪数据库操作历史,及时发现并处理潜在的安全威胁或误操作

     二、MySQL服务登陆的基本步骤 MySQL服务登陆通常涉及以下几个关键步骤,从准备阶段到成功登陆,每一步都至关重要

     1.安装与配置MySQL: - 在服务器上安装MySQL软件

     - 配置MySQL服务,包括设置root密码、创建用户账户、分配权限等

    这一步骤通常在MySQL首次安装时完成,也可根据需要后续调整

     2.准备登陆凭证: - 确定要使用的用户名和密码

    对于初次登陆,通常是root用户及其密码

     -如果是远程登陆,还需确保MySQL服务器允许远程连接,并开放相应的端口(默认为3306)

     3.选择合适的登陆工具: - MySQL命令行客户端(mysql):适用于熟悉命令行操作的用户,提供最直接、高效的登陆方式

     -图形化管理工具(如MySQL Workbench、phpMyAdmin):适合初学者或需要直观界面的用户,简化数据库管理和操作

     4.执行登陆命令: - 使用命令行客户端时,打开终端或命令提示符,输入`mysql -u用户名 -p`,然后按提示输入密码

     - 在图形化管理工具中,填写服务器地址、端口、用户名和密码等信息,点击连接按钮

     5.验证登陆成功: - 成功登陆后,MySQL命令行客户端会显示欢迎信息,并进入MySQL提示符(如`mysql`)

     -图形化管理工具则会展示数据库列表、表结构等信息,表明已成功连接到MySQL服务器

     三、常见问题及解决方案 尽管MySQL服务登陆看似简单,但在实际操作中,用户可能会遇到各种问题

    以下是一些常见问题及其解决方案: 1.无法连接到MySQL服务器: - 检查MySQL服务是否已启动

     - 确认服务器地址和端口号是否正确

     - 检查防火墙设置,确保MySQL端口未被阻塞

     - 如果是远程连接,还需检查MySQL配置文件(如`my.cnf`或`my.ini`),确保`bind-address`参数允许远程访问

     2.用户名或密码错误: - 确认输入的用户名和密码是否正确

     -尝试重置密码,使用`ALTER USER 用户名@主机 IDENTIFIED BY 新密码;`命令

     3.权限不足: - 检查当前用户是否具有执行所需操作的权限

     - 使用具有足够权限的用户账户登陆,或联系数据库管理员申请所需权限

     4.客户端版本与服务器不兼容: - 确保客户端软件版本与MySQL服务器版本兼容

     -如有必要,升级客户端软件或降级MySQL服务器版本

     四、提升MySQL服务登陆安全性的策略 随着网络攻击手段的不断演变,加强MySQL服务登陆的安全性变得尤为重要

    以下策略有助于提升MySQL服务的安全性: 1.使用强密码策略: - 要求用户采用复杂密码,包含大小写字母、数字和特殊字符

     - 定期更换密码,避免长期使用同一密码

     2.限制登陆尝试次数: - 配置MySQL服务器,限制同一IP地址在一定时间内的登陆尝试次数,超过限制则暂时封锁该IP

     3.启用SSL/TLS加密: - 为MySQL连接启用SSL/TLS加密,保护数据传输过程中的安全,防止数据被窃听或篡改

     4.实施多因素认证: - 除了用户名和密码外,增加额外的认证因素,如短信验证码、硬件令牌等,提高账户安全性

     5.定期审查用户权限: - 定期审查数据库用户账户及其权限,撤销不再需要的账户或权限,遵循最小权限原则

     6.监控与日志审计: -启用MySQL的审计日志功能,记录所有登陆尝试和操作日志

     - 使用监控工具实时跟踪数据库活动,及时发现并响应异常行为

     7.保持软件更新: - 定期更新MySQL服务器和客户端软件,修复已知的安全漏洞

     五、结语 MySQL服务登陆作为数据库管理的起点,其重要性不言而喻

    通过掌握基本的登陆步骤、解决常见问题的方法以及提升安全性的策略,用户可以更有效地管理和维护MySQL数据库,确保数据的安全、完整和高效利用

    在这个过程中,持续学习和实践是关键,随着技术的不断进步,保持对最新安全威胁和防护措施的敏感度,将帮助用户在这条数据库管理的道路上越走越远

    无论是初学者还是经验丰富的数据库管理员,都应将MySQL服务登陆视为一项基本技能,不断精进,以适应日益复杂的数据环境挑战

    

阅读全文
上一篇:MySQL基础:掌握这些简单SQL语句,轻松查询数据库

最新收录:

  • 小程序云函数高效连接MySQL指南
  • MySQL基础:掌握这些简单SQL语句,轻松查询数据库
  • MySQL表数据快速导出至Excel指南
  • MySQL中的约束条件声明技巧
  • MySQL与.mdf文件:数据迁移解析
  • 阿里云分布式MySQL数据库解析
  • MySQL Window客户端:高效管理数据库的必备工具
  • MySQL数据拆分与解析技巧
  • Docker中MySQL备份全攻略
  • 警惕!MySQL中的Pig4444病毒入侵解析
  • MySQL表优化提速技巧揭秘
  • Excel64位高效连接MySQL数据库技巧
  • 首页 | mysql服务登陆:MySQL服务登陆指南:轻松入门教程